a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authororeodave <aryadevchavali1@gmail.com>2020-04-07 09:43:41 +0100
committeroreodave <aryadevchavali1@gmail.com>2020-04-07 09:44:05 +0100
commit093ae443b98cc62eb05622f4a1b823489888fcc6 (patch)
treed9de0924acc2d5601654a2b2af5131ca18eb8984
parentaf69bf851eca0a5145078914d5837145dc115ff3 (diff)
downloaddotfiles-093ae443b98cc62eb05622f4a1b823489888fcc6.tar.gz
dotfiles-093ae443b98cc62eb05622f4a1b823489888fcc6.tar.bz2
dotfiles-093ae443b98cc62eb05622f4a1b823489888fcc6.zip
~zshenv -> zshrc
Don't use oh-my-zsh anymore, too clunky
-rw-r--r--files2
-rw-r--r--zshrc (renamed from zshenv)11
2 files changed, 11 insertions, 2 deletions
diff --git a/files b/files
index f210f18..890be3f 100644
--- a/files
+++ b/files
@@ -1 +1 @@
-tmux.conf vimrc zshenv doom.d mpd mpv alacritty.yml ncmpcpp i3status.conf
+tmux.conf vimrc zshrc doom.d mpd mpv alacritty.yml ncmpcpp i3status.conf
diff --git a/zshenv b/zshrc
index de95342..bc1524f 100644
--- a/zshenv
+++ b/zshrc
@@ -1,5 +1,6 @@
# zshenv -*- mode: sh; lexical-binding: t; -*-
-# Important variables
+
+# Important variables and stuff
export P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:~/.local/bin:~/Bin/binaries:~/.emacs.d/bin:~/.cargo/bin:~/Scripts
export guile=guile2.2
export PF_INFO="ascii title os memory uptime editor shell"
@@ -14,6 +15,14 @@ export XDG_RUNTIME_DIR=/run/user/`id -u`
export DOTNET_SKIP_FIRST_TIME_EXPERIENCE=true
export DOTNET_CLI_TELEMTRY_OPTOUT=1
+autoload -U colors && colors
+autoload -U compinit
+HISTSIZE=10000
+SAVEHIST=10000
+zstyle ':completion:*' menu select
+zmodload zsh/complist
+compinit
+
# Programming
editor() {
nohup emacs $@ > /dev/null &